The Senior Electrical Engineer is responsible for ensuring the quality and timely delivery of engineering designs and reports, particularly in the areas of power distribution and electrical systems for process and industrial facilities. This role involves direct client interaction, conducting site visits, and providing hands-on support. Responsibilities include preparing specifications and data sheets, conducting power system analysis and relay coordination, and supporting programming for various electrical equipment. The position also requires experience in project leadership, including budget and schedule development, and occasional travel to client sites and Nexus offices. 

Responsibilities

  • Power Distribution & Electrical System Designs for Process/Industrial Facilities
  • Specifications and Data Sheets (Transformers, Switchgear, Motors, UPS etc.)
  • Vendor Inquiries, Bid Evaluations, and Shop Drawing Reviews
  • Power System Analysis and Relay Coordination
  • Area Classification and Electrical Code Assessments
  • Construction Labor/Material Cost Estimates and Project Schedules
  • Programming/Set points (VFDs, Relay Protection, Etc.) and Field Support

Qualifications

  • 10+ years of experience in designing electrical distribution/control systems and performing power system calculations
  • High Voltage Substation Design (up to 345 kV) experience preferred
  • Subsurface and overhead transmission line design experience preferred
  • Project lead experience developing engineering schedules, budgets and forecasts
  • Working knowledge of Microsoft Office products including MS Project
  • AutoCAD and 3-D CAD experience a plus
  • Electrical design tools and calculations
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Ability to work effectively in teams and to present a positive image to clients

Education/Certification Requirements

  • Bachelor of Science in Electrical Engineering required
  • Advanced degree a plus
  • FE certification desired, PE certification a plus

What We Do

Nexus Engineering Group is a full-service, independent engineering firm focused on supporting clients’ specific project goals from concept to startup. With more than a dozen years of proven engineering and design successes, Nexus is the preferred engineering firm of choice when seeking integrity and expertise. Nexus performs best when faced with complex and demanding projects in the refining, petroleum midstream, chemical, manufacturing and utilities industries. Our teams have the talent and moxie to tackle all sizes of projects for local and international clients seeking to design, build, and construct highly technical and functional facilities.
